   1/* SPDX-License-Identifier: GPL-2.0 */
   2#ifndef _ASM_POWERPC_SECTIONS_H
   3#define _ASM_POWERPC_SECTIONS_H
   4#ifdef __KERNEL__
   5
   6#include <linux/elf.h>
   7#include <linux/uaccess.h>
   8#include <asm-generic/sections.h>
   9
  10extern char __head_end[];
  11
  12#ifdef __powerpc64__
  13
  14extern char __start_interrupts[];
  15extern char __end_interrupts[];
  16
  17extern char __prom_init_toc_start[];
  18extern char __prom_init_toc_end[];
  19
  20static inline int in_kernel_text(unsigned long addr)
  21{
  22        if (addr >= (unsigned long)_stext && addr < (unsigned long)__init_end)
  23                return 1;
  24
  25        return 0;
  26}
  27
  28static inline unsigned long kernel_toc_addr(void)
  29{
  30        /* Defined by the linker, see vmlinux.lds.S */
  31        extern unsigned long __toc_start;
  32
  33        /*
  34         * The TOC register (r2) points 32kB into the TOC, so that 64kB of
  35         * the TOC can be addressed using a single machine instruction.
  36         */
  37        return (unsigned long)(&__toc_start) + 0x8000UL;
  38}
  39
  40static inline int overlaps_interrupt_vector_text(unsigned long start,
  41                                                        unsigned long end)
  42{
  43        unsigned long real_start, real_end;
  44        real_start = __start_interrupts - _stext;
  45        real_end = __end_interrupts - _stext;
  46
  47        return start < (unsigned long)__va(real_end) &&
  48                (unsigned long)__va(real_start) < end;
  49}
  50
  51static inline int overlaps_kernel_text(unsigned long start, unsigned long end)
  52{
  53        return start < (unsigned long)__init_end &&
  54                (unsigned long)_stext < end;
  55}
  56
  57static inline int overlaps_kvm_tmp(unsigned long start, unsigned long end)
  58{
  59#ifdef CONFIG_KVM_GUEST
  60        extern char kvm_tmp[];
  61        return start < (unsigned long)kvm_tmp &&
  62                (unsigned long)&kvm_tmp[1024 * 1024] < end;
  63#else
  64        return 0;
  65#endif
  66}
  67
  68#ifdef PPC64_ELF_ABI_v1
  69#undef dereference_function_descriptor
  70static inline void *dereference_function_descriptor(void *ptr)
  71{
  72        struct ppc64_opd_entry *desc = ptr;
  73        void *p;
  74
  75        if (!probe_kernel_address(&desc->funcaddr, p))
  76                ptr = p;
  77        return ptr;
  78}
  79#endif /* PPC64_ELF_ABI_v1 */
  80
  81#endif
  82
  83#endif /* __KERNEL__ */
  84#endif  /* _ASM_POWERPC_SECTIONS_H */
